1,659 IDP families leave Jalozai for Swat.


NOWSHERA, July 19, 2009 (Frontier Star) -- In third phase of repatriation Repatriation

Jalozai camp in-charge Tahir Orakzai told INP INP

 that a caravan varying 1,659 families comprising 11,613 persons left for Mingora on Sunday. Giving the details of the transport arrangements made by the provincial government, he said that 659 families were commuted through the official transport while 1,000 families, living with their relatives out of camps arranged their own transport to get back to their native areas. Aurakzai said that the government wished to arrange transport facilities for return back of all IDPs families however due to some problems it was not immediately possible and the IDPs families which were cognizant for early return to their native lands arranged private transport and left the camp. He said that all efforts were being made to facilitate the IDPs families returning back and besides pledges Rs. 25000 a month ration was also provided to them. He said that life in Swat was coming to normal as security forces have cleared most of the area of militants and it was hoped that displaced persons residing in various IDPs camps and other places across the country would return back and lead and willing life their.
